Heads of famous Germans

Heads of Famous Germans was a permanent series of stamps issued by the Deutsche Reichspost on November 1, 1926 ; a supplementary value followed in 1927 . On October 10, 1927, at the meeting of the International Labor Office in Berlin, three values ​​were provided with a two-line label ("IAA / October 10–15 , 1927 ") and issued as a special temporary edition .

Printing process and validity

The stamps were made in the letterpress process on coated paper with the watermark 2 waffles , the comb perforation is 14:14 1/4. There is no reliable information on the circulation of definitive stamps.

The 13 definitive stamps were valid until June 30, 1933, the three special stamps from October 10, 1927 only until November 30, 1927.

In order to prevent the misuse of the trademarks, authorities and companies were allowed to punch holes in the acquired trademarks .
